By the way, for those interested..
Universal Aero Sport sleeve bags over my shitty coils.
VU4 4-corner management
7-switch box
(2) 444c Viair compressors
5-gal tank
Pieced it all together, very close to Jaycray's RSX if anyone is familiar. Only difference was he was on BC coils.

Got my switch box wired up to my VU4. Ordered some more misc. stuff. Going to be building the struts next week. Very well could be hitting switches by next Sunday.
Coilovers are no longer coilovers due to the machining required to fit the sleeve bags over them, but they fit and it's going to work fantastic from what mock ups are telling me! May be doing more work to the fronts in order to flip my tie rod ends so they don't bottom out on the strut tower and hold me up. Tank showed up as well.
